
Finding Events
The fastest way to start playing with Philly Volleyball is Opensports. We use the app to organize and publicize events (pickup events, tournaments, and leagues can all be found on the app), so that's where you'll be able to see what events are happening, and sign up for them.
- Download the Opensports app
- Create an account
- Add a payment method
- Join the Philadelphia Volleyball group, and get a membership (the free one is fine until your ready to play more events.)
- Select and join an event

Just getting started with volleyball?
Volleyball is an amazing sport once you get into it, and become more fun the better you get. Serving and Receiving get more consistent, plays get more exciting, and rallies last longer. The only way to really get better, is to play more, and get more touches with the ball. Look for events that are labeled for "Beginner", "Recreational", or "All Levels". Once you get comfortable with the basics, you can move on the events labeled for "B" level players.
We also have some clinics available (some run by Philadelphia Volleyball and some by partners or local coaches)

New to Philadelphia?
Just moved to Philly? (or just stopping by?) Welcome to the City of Brotherly Love!
We try to make it easy to join the community here, with all our events being posted publicly on Opensports. No secret group chat. No Membership applications. Just join us on the app, sign up for an event, and start playing.
If you’re looking for a team, we have a free agent spreadsheet for players put their name down on, and form teams before the season. We highly encourage going to pickup events to meet people in person and make teams as it usually results in a better league experience.
We use a similar rating system similar to other regions (with B being the lowest level of competition and AA being the highest (not including Open) If you feel unsure, check out our rating guidelines.
Joining a team
While we are a non-profit sports club, we’re not a traditional volleyball club in the sense that we don’t have tryouts or a specific team to join. If you are just looking to play volleyball, we offer many pickup events—one-off 2-3 hour sessions—that you can signup for solo (or with friends) which is a great way to meet people and find teams. Pickup events are the best ways to meet people and find/create a team.
We do run leagues and tournaments where you sign up with your own team (or join an existing team) but teams are all created/organized by players, not Philadelphia Volleyball as an organization. Some of our beginner and intermediate level leagues may have an official free agent signup if they don't initially fill with full teams teams, and you can sign up for those on opensports.
